Kerala

Created in 1956, Kerala is a state in the southwestern part of India. With an area of 15,005 sq mi, the state is bordered by the Arabian Sea on the west, Tamil Nadu to the south and the east and Karnataka to the north.

Describe Kerala Nair Wedding?

It was known as "Pudamury" or Pudava Kodukkal. The groom give the new clothes to the bride and take her as his wife. They exchange tulsi garlands. This was some 200 years ago.

Now Nair weddings are celebrated with much more rituals and pomp. However, the essence remains simple. Main components are 'Thalikettu' (tying the knot), the handing over the 'Mantra kodi' (usually a Sari in decorated tray) by the bride groom to the bride and finally the 'Kai pidichu Kodukkal'. (brides father handing over the bride to the bridegroom by holding their hands together.)

How do foreigners get married in kerala?

Foreigners can get married in Kerala by following the legal requirements set by Indian law. They must provide valid passports, visa documents, and, if previously married, a divorce decree or death certificate of the former spouse. The couple needs to register their marriage under the Special Marriage Act, which involves submitting an application to the local marriage registrar and attending a notice period of 30 days. It's advisable to consult with a local lawyer or marriage bureau for guidance through the process.

Is mudaliar caste from tamilnadu is equal to nair caste in kerala?

The Mudaliar caste in Tamil Nadu and the Nair caste in Kerala are distinct communities with different historical and cultural backgrounds. While both are considered influential in their respective regions and have similar status as forward castes, they belong to different ethnic and social frameworks. The Mudaliars are primarily associated with landownership and administration, whereas the Nairs have a different social structure, often linked to matrilineal traditions. Thus, while they may share some similarities, they are not equivalent.

Who is the first Muslim ruler in kerala?

The first Muslim ruler in Kerala is generally considered to be Malik Ibn Dinar, an Arab trader and missionary who arrived in the region in the 7th century. He is credited with establishing one of the first mosques in India, the Cheraman Juma Mosque in Kodungallur. His arrival marked the beginning of Islam's influence in Kerala, leading to the establishment of a Muslim community in the region. Over time, various Muslim dynasties emerged, further shaping Kerala's socio-political landscape.

Who is the first Arabian traveller went to kerala?

The first notable Arabian traveler to visit Kerala is believed to be Ibn Battuta, a Moroccan explorer who traveled extensively in the 14th century. His accounts include descriptions of his journeys to the Indian subcontinent, including the Malabar Coast of Kerala. However, earlier trade links existed between Arabia and Kerala, facilitated by Arab merchants who engaged in spice trade long before Ibn Battuta's time. These interactions laid the groundwork for cultural and economic exchanges between the regions.
